This role will involve Nurse management, leading the nursing team, responding to changes in nursing practice and reporting to the practice manager and senior GP partner. The Practice is offering pastoral support to the post holder by way of mentorship with a senior established ANP. Clinical roles include, but not limited to Assess, plan, develop, implement and evaluate programmes which promote health and well being, and prevent adverse effects on health and well being Assess, plan, develop, implement and evaluate individual treatment plans for patient with a known long term condition Proactively identify, diagnose and manage treatment plans for patients at risk of developing a long term condition as appropriate. Undertakes agreed procedures eg - blood pressure, pulse rate and rhythm, temperature, height and weight body mass index, venepuncture, ear syringing, ECG, peak flow readings, cytology, travel and childhood vaccinations, interpretation of blood results via the pathology link Prioritise health problems and intervene appropriately to assist the patient in complex, urgent or emergency situations, including initiating effective emergency care. Review medication for therapeutic effectiveness, appropriate to patients needs and in accordance with evidence based practice and national and practice protocols Lead on wound care management, participate in immunisation programmes for both adults and children Lead on Nursing staff appraisals, day to day management of the nursing team.
